George VI was the King of Great Britain (1936-1952) and the second son of George V. He succeeded Edward VIII (his older brother) after Edward abdicated the throne. He married Lady Elizabeth Bowes-Lyon (later known as the Queen Mother) and was succeeded by Elizabeth II.
